Transaction a6778e66f4cab1bd3bd6cc53b63b373737f81fd700431192b64fd27fa27006fa
1 Input
1 Output
-
a6778e66f4cab1bd3bd6cc53b63b373737f81fd700431192b64fd27fa27006fa:0
- value
- 30150228
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1dd7da5be63600bb0690e73c26fea20a264906e
- address
- bc1q68whmfd7vdsqhvrfpeeuyml2yz3xfyrwuzwft0